    Interesting question, but you could also ask what incentive is there to change? Leather is known to work in the environment encountered (oil / steam /heat / pressure etc); isn't particularly expensive; can be easily obtained in the small quantities needed; can be worked with very simple tools to the shape required (e.g. a Stanley knife or similar). If you changed material, you would have to find one that met all those conditions and may after extensive trials prove not to be much of an advantage.

    Electric rivet heaters are great. I acquired one about 25 years ago and had it transported to the NYMR. Unknown to me, their so-called electrical engineer condemned it on site because it had water cooled anvils and he considered that mixed water and electricity and threw it into the scrap skip. To say I was a trifle annoyed when I found out is an understatement. Never seen another one since.

    Not sure that this is the same thing. The type I'm referring to basically passed a current through the rivet, a bit like an electric welder, which heated it up to a nice white heat, depending on the current passing through it. Like this:

    CAMELOT TO WORK THE MINEHEAD BRANCH IN OCTOBER

    West Somerset Railway Plc have announced:

    It has just been confirmed that BR Standard Class 5 no 73082 Camelot will be visiting us for the Autumn Steam Gala! It is very rare for the Bluebell Railway to let their home-based locomotives visit other railways so we thank both the railway and the locomotive's owners (73082 Camelot Locomotive Society) for this exciting opportunity.
